Transaction 0c2e54b7717160c40005a81e83bf3919c71fd0ff7730e6431e4195a930fa9892
1 Input
1 Output
-
0c2e54b7717160c40005a81e83bf3919c71fd0ff7730e6431e4195a930fa9892:0
- value
- 529232
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ff526686fbaffa30b20945047a14e584bfac8a6c OP_EQUAL
- address
- 3Qy2wkJbQwameH7rCU3phrMcwYreLaWPdF